Marron Glacé is a delicacy that consists of chestnuts that have been preserved and coated in sugar. This sweet treat has been enjoyed for centuries and is a popular dessert in many countries around the world. The process of making Marron Glacé involves candying chestnuts in a sugar syrup until they become tender and have absorbed the sweetness of the sugar. The chestnuts are then coated in a glossy sugar glaze, giving them a shiny and attractive appearance. The result is a decadent and luxurious treat that is perfect for special occasions or as a gourmet gift. Marron Glacé is often enjoyed on its own as a sweet treat, but it can also be used to add a touch of elegance to desserts such as ice cream, cakes, and pastries.
